Bus fares will have to be increased by Wednesday: Minister Dilum Amunugama

Date:

The bus fares will have to be increased by Wednesday (29), said State Minister of Transport Dilum Amunugama, speaking to a ceremony held in Ankumbura, Kandy yesterday (26).

“We may have to go for a revision of the bus fares next week. We are hoping to go for a minimum rise. We have to go for such a revision because there is a drop in the prices of fuel and there is a law on the number of seats available for passengers due to Covid. These, we are not allowed to remove.

When the law is lifted, we may have to revise the fare by a small amount by Wednesday, on the condition that it too will be removed. We are not doing these willingly,” he said.
